Position Overview
We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Life Settlement Specialist to join our team in Queens, New York. This role will focus on the acquisition of life insurance policies and the evaluation, structuring, and execution of policy conversions within the life settlements market. The ideal candidate will have a strong understanding of life insurance products, investor dynamics, and transaction execution.
Key Responsibilities
- Source and originate life insurance policy acquisition opportunities through brokers, agents, and direct channels
- Evaluate policies for life settlement eligibility, including face value, insured profile, and policy structure
- Lead end-to-end transaction execution, including underwriting coordination, pricing analysis, and closing processes
- Structure and execute policy conversions (e.g., term conversions, policy optimization strategies) to maximize asset value
- Build and maintain relationships with brokers, financial advisors, and policyholders
- Collaborate with internal investment, legal, and compliance teams to ensure smooth execution of transactions
- Maintain accurate pipeline tracking, reporting, and documentation of all acquisition activities
- Stay informed on regulatory developments and market trends within the life settlements industry
